Activison Financial Statement Reveals Cancellation and New Titles

by Rainier on Feb. 6, 2006 @ 3:36 p.m. PST | Filed under News

Activison today released its quaterly financial statement and although revenues were up 20%, net income was down 30&. As usual the real interesting info came during the conference call afterwards where Activision revealed the console edition of The Movies was cancelled, True Crime and GUN performed below expectations, although a sequel for GUN is likely, unlike True Crime. Tony Hawk returns in 2006 with Tony Hawk: Downhill Jam and also Call of Duty will get another episode. Activision plans to release 4 X360 titles this year, as well as 3 PS3, and one Revolution, launch titles.

Perpetual Adds Visionary Star Trek Artist To Its Dev. Team

by Rainier on Feb. 6, 2006 @ 12:36 p.m. PST | Filed under News

Star Trek Online developer Perpetual Entertainment announced that Andrew Probert has joined the Star Trek Online development team as design consultant. As the Senior Illustrator for the first season of Star Trek: The Next Generation, Probert designed new spacecraft ranging from the Ferengi Marauder and the Romulan warbird to the Galaxy-class U.S.S. Enterprise NCC-1701-D, including both its main and battle bridges.

Indiana Violent Video Games Bill Struck Down

by Rainier on Feb. 2, 2006 @ 3:02 p.m. PST | Filed under News

Indiana Democratic State Senator Vi Simpson and Republican State Senator Dennis Kruse introduced SB 135, a bill that would fine retailers who rent or sell violent and/or sexually explicit games to minors. It also would have required a sticker with an 18 age requirement to be put on violent games. Unfortunately for the senators they couldnt muster enough of their colleagues to even give it an initial vote within the deadline, which ended today, and is now consdiered dead (thanks Gamepolitics).

'The Kojima Productions Report' Audioblog Launched

by Rainier on Feb. 2, 2006 @ 1:57 a.m. PST | Filed under News

Metal Gear video game series creator, Mr. Hideo Kojima, has opened The Kojima Productions Report, a new audioblog in English. Hosted by Kojima Productions' International Manager Ryan Payton, the "Report" will offer new audio sessions every week. Tune in and hear about the latest on the inner workings at the Kojima Productions studio, including commentary by various staff and guest VIPs.
